General Description:

Performs highly complex (senior-level) database and application administration work in the Information Systems Division. Work involves defining, monitoring, maintaining, developing and tuning integrated database system environments for ERS application areas. Works primarily within Microsoft SQL Server and related application environments. Also actively explores the need and application of AI and data analysis for DBA duties in the near future. Works under limited direction of the Database Administrator Team Lead with considerable latitude for the use of initiative and independent judgment.

Duties and Responsibilities

Essential Functions:

  • Provides accurate and timely system and database administration for ERS Plans database server layout, conducts SQL Server instance capacity planning. Implements and manages databases and environments to provide healthy, robust, and scalable database platforms. Insures the integrity, reliability and performance of the database environment for development, test, and production systems.
  • Provides accurate and timely technical support for application client/server and web environments, including development, test and production Provides technical assistance to development, end-user and other staff.
  • Installs, configures, upgrades, and patches database software, application software and other supporting products. Coordinates activities with vendors as necessary for timely installation, software upgrades and maintenance as well as configuration and management ensuring use of best-practices.
